Transaction 37dee75f896e02313e523febed691a4dec152b4af0cff484e35f125032c71e3e
1 Input
2 Outputs
- 37dee75f896e02313e523febed691a4dec152b4af0cff484e35f125032c71e3e:0
- 37dee75f896e02313e523febed691a4dec152b4af0cff484e35f125032c71e3e:1
value 72950375
address 1FrSsMAShLTr4jvnfKjEKskzkyWDDWqWni
value 9900000
address 33HCtt7YLvR2yGC5WGNZeC6GHve2ejohKx